Not worth the price
After a few months of using both the Shield wallet and the key holder, I have to say I’m not overly impressed. When I first got them, I was genuinely looking forward to something that looked sleek, minimal, and supposedly “premium.” Unfortunately, that excitement faded fast once I started using them day to day.
The biggest issue for me is durability. Both the wallet and the key holder pick up scratches far too easily — and I’m not talking about being rough or careless. Just normal use, sitting in my pocket, and they already look worn out. For the price these go for, I expected them to handle daily wear much better.
Out of curiosity, I decided to compare them to a cheap set I bought online — a simple card holder and key holder from AliExpress that cost me around £12 total for both. Honestly? I can’t tell the difference. They feel the same, look the same, and even the finish and materials seem identical. If anything, the cheaper ones have held up just as well, maybe even a little better.
That’s when it really hit me: you’re basically paying a premium price for branding and packaging. Once they’re out of the box, there’s nothing that justifies the cost difference. The Shield stuff might look nice when new, but the moment you start using it, it becomes clear it’s nothing special.
If you’re thinking about buying these, I’d honestly say just save your money and grab something off AliExpress or Amazon instead. You’ll get the same thing for a fraction of the price — without the disappointment.
Looks premium, feels average, and scratches like crazy. Definitely not worth what they’re charging.
